### Alert: PayFjord integration test flakes > 20%

Fires when nightly integration runs against the Ledgerline sandbox exceed a 20% failure rate. Usually sandbox token expiry, not product code. Check the token refresher job first. If failures are in settlement specs, treat as real: freeze deploys and bisect. Do not silence for more than one cycle. Retry the suite once before paging anyone else. Route persistent flake reports to the address below.

pager mailbox: druwyn@norvaio.corp

Changelog 4.7.0 — Lanternfruit Catalog Service. The setting CATALOG_CACHE_FLUSH_MODE has been renamed to CATALOG_INVALIDATION_STRATEGY to better reflect that it controls per-SKU invalidation, not full flushes. The old name is accepted until 5.0 with a deprecation warning. Release managers should update deployment templates before cutting the next tag. Note that the invalidation webhook now requires signed requests, so each environment needs a signing credential in its env file. Add the following line under the caching section.

env line for bageg-tajef: LEDGER_TOKEN5=ba616

When users upload text files to Driftbox, the ingest worker runs charset sniffing via the Lexiprobe service before parsing. Lexiprobe returns a confidence score; anything below 0.82 falls back to UTF-8 with replacement characters, which triggers the `encoding.lowconf` alert you may be paged for. Most false alarms come from legacy Latin-2 exports from the Varnholm archive migration. To query Lexiprobe directly during an incident, call its diagnostics endpoint with the on-call credential. The key is issued per rotation and appears below.

API key for yahig-tadup: kto7_ubizbYm